Did Victorian ladies shave?

In the Victorian era, ladies with excess facial or body hair didn't have the luxury of making an appointment at their local salon. Instead, women employed various methods of hair removal at home. There was shaving and tweezing, of course, but there were also more dangerous methods.

Did ladies shave in the 1800s?

Before the 20th century, women were only socially required to remove unsightly hair from the face and neck (virtually the only parts of their bodies not covered by clothes) but they would do this using homemade or industrial depilatory creams, not with razors.

When did body hair become unattractive?

By the early 1900s, upper- and middle-class white America increasingly saw smooth skin as a marker of femininity, and female body hair as disgusting, with its removal offering "a way to separate oneself from cruder people, lower class and immigrant," Herzig wrote.

When did females start shaving armpits?

The removal of armpit and leg hair by American women became a new practice in the early 20th century due to a confluence of multiple factors. One cultural change was the definition of femininity. In the Victorian era, it was based on moral character.

Why are female armpits attractive?

An experiment has demonstrated that there is a consensus among men about what they find most attractive in a female armpit, and that the key ingredient appears to be the smells associated with oestradiol, which peak when women are ovulating. The research involved 28 women and 57 men.

When did females start shaving legs?

According to the book "The body project", women started shaving their legs in the 1920's when skirts became shorter.
